# Building Access — Landlord Site Audit

Grayfell Properties will audit Tollmane House on the 14th. Assistants: clear corridors, remove door wedges, and ensure fire doors latch. Auditors arrive 09:00, escorted by Facilities. Do not lend personal badges. Escort any auditor needing the records annex yourself, using the temporary pass code issued below.

turnstile pass: bdg-QZV-3

Action item from the Mirewater tide-table widget incident. Owner: release manager. Widget cached stale harbor offsets after the DST change, showing tides six hours off for two days. Required: add a cache-invalidation check to the release checklist, block deploys when offset tables are older than 24 hours, and verify the Saltgate harbor feed before each cut. Deadline: next release. Checklist template and sign-off procedure are documented on the internal page below.

wiki page, kawif-bajep: https://artifactory.zarqelforge.internal/issue/browse/display/display/projects/spaces/secrets/000fe6ec5a46af29355003e1

ALERT: Timetable solver stall (Scheddle)

Fires when the Scheddle constraint solver exceeds 20 minutes on a single school run. Usually caused by malformed room-capacity constraints or a teacher-availability import loop. Do not kill the worker mid-solve; checkpoint recovery is flaky. Mark the run paused, grab the constraint dump, and requeue with the relaxed profile. If three consecutive runs stall, escalate to the Planwright team. Triage steps and known bad constraint patterns are documented here.

dashboard of tawef-hagug = https://superset.norvadyn.local/display/projects/build/ticket/build/spaces/ticket/1e989f0e6c200d20fc4ae06b